Switchblade Keyless Entry Fobs

A key fob can do much more than simply unlock the car and start it. It also serves as a security device and a deterrent to theft. High-tech key fobs today are more reliable, efficient and secure than they have ever been. The high cost of these devices can make it expensive to replace them if you lose or break one.

A basic mini lost key fob might be a couple of dollars to buy but programming it can set you back more than $200. Those costs are even higher for high-end vehicles or those equipped with extra features. Some basic warranties or insurance coverage programs may provide the replacement fob, however the majority of people have to shell out hundreds out of pocket for having their fob repaired.

Some newer cars also come with a fob that functions as a smart keys. They can lock, unlock, or activate an alarm with the pressing of a button. They can also summon your car similar to Tesla's summon feature however, they must be within proximity to the vehicle in order to operate.

The type of fob you choose to use has a metal lock that folds in the fob, similar to an ad-hoc switchblade. A spring holds the key inside when it's not in use, and you can pop it out at the push of a button for access to the vehicle. A switchblade fob generally costs approximately the same as a standard key fob with metal keys.

Keyless Entry Fobs With Side Mirrors Folding

Key fobs of today are loaded with more modern electronics than ever before, and this plastic piece of equipment does a lot more than simply lock or unlock the doors and start the car remotely. Depending on the model, it may be able to make chirping sounds that aid you in finding your car in a parking area or can be used as an audio remote to control your car's radio stations.

One of the most useful hidden functions is found on a few modern models that permit you to lower all the windows at once by pressing a button on your key fob. This is great in the summer heat when the air conditioning doesn't do the job. The sequence of buttons to activate the feature isn't always labeled and you might have to test a few different combinations until you discover one that works with your vehicle.

If you're a lover of tight spaces the key fobs in newer Chevrolet and GMC vehicles can help out by automatically folding the vehicle's side mirrors when you lock the car. To enable this feature, just press the "lock button" on the fob and hold it for a full 2 seconds.

Keyless Entry Fobs that connect to Bluetooth

With the popularity of smart keys as well as smartphone car access, criminals have been given an easy way to steal cars. Wireless protocols that these systems use are susceptible to hijacking by criminals who are able to spoof the signal from the key fob or smartphone to unlock and start your car.

A key fob is a small, programmable hardware token that offers one-factor authentication on the device to allow access to a physical object like a car computer system, restricted area, room or mobile device. The fob transmits wireless signals to the sensor, which recognizes and executes predetermined commands.

In many cases, the key fob can also be used as a security token. It can be used for two-factor or multiple-factor authentication (2FA and MFA) to provide added security. This is usually done by adding biometric verification to the equation. For example fingerprints or iris, or even a voiceprint can be used.
